Introduction

Over the years, I've seen forms of this discussion pop up in-game and among friends. Many players are and have been craving a strong economic system to replace some of the archaic features of the Bazaar. MMORPG games are typically just as good as their economic system. Games such as EVE Online and Star Wars The Old Republic have well-established economies that allow players to not only benefit from the availability of items, but profit off of their own wares. As the player base for this game begins to collectively grow older and more mature, I believe a market/auction system would be quite appropriate and necessary to improve Q.O.L in the game.

Items Sold In the Market

This market/auction system would include but not be limited to the transfer of reagents and items between players. Certain items would have suggested values, such as Crown Shop items or items that are harder to acquire, such as the Level 130 Dragoon's set. Eventually, players would establish understood values of items and be able to fairly compete with other members. Reagents such as Amber or Vine, which are only acquired through drops or using Arena Tickets would also carry a more significant price, especially in bulk. This should also open up the ability to trade items & reagents among friends. Perhaps a system similar to that of gifting could be used for this, so that players must voluntarily elect to take part in these trades.

The Gold Predicament
Naturally, for this system to run smoothly, a heavily requested update would be necessary. Personally, I'd love to see the Gold limit be completely removed, so that players can reach any potential level of wealth that they aspire to reach, but a gradual increase in the gold limit would be acceptable as well. For players who have completed the main storyline, the markets could easily provide an additional activity to take part in.


Kingsisle's Involvement in the Markets
While there are plenty of benefits of offering a free market system to every player, there are downsides. The possibility of Monopolies and unfair business practices exists, which means that Kingsisle would need to implement systems that would limit those possibilities. While it is important that players run the markets, Kingsisle would need to initially set price standards for certain items, so that as an item's availability or rarity increases, the prices would appropriately fluctuate.


Badges
Naturally, players will aspire to reach high levels of wealth through the use of the market system. Badges accompany certain milestones in players' achievements, so there should be badges that commemorate a player's achievement of becoming a Millionaire, Billionaire, and above! This would provide an additional incentive for players to contribute to the markets, as they can proudly flaunt their success among their peers.


Conclusion
All in all, I believe a player-run market/auction system would increase the quality-of-life for every player in the game, provide an incentive for many players to join/come back to the game, and provide an additional reason for players who don't participate in PvP to continue playing the game. This would be an expansive update, but the long-term benefits of it would easily overshadow any difficulties of implementation. It's time that Wizard101 truly surpasses the other iconic MMORPG games, and an in-game player-run market system would greatly contribute to that.
